When I first saw this game I said to myself "this looks really stupid". Another example of the phrase "don't judge a book by it's cover". This game is really great. I like to think of it as Goldeneye except you are a toy plane or car and there is no blood.
You are in a house; in each area (hallway, childrens rooms, dining room) there is a toy boss and if you beat him in a head to head battle, he becomes your ally. There are various missions where you have a certain goal like to blow up the bridge or to rescue a doll. When you form your "army" of toys you are ready to take on the Toy Commander in the final showdown. The game is also multi player so you can play with your friends. As always the graphics are spectacular and the controls are easy to learn.
I had only played this game briefly and because I enjoyed it so much I recently ordered it from Amazon.com. The game is not only for kids because many missions are very challenging. Bottom line: if you have Sega Dreamcast I suggest trying Toy Commander because it is a really good game.
